Output 6f524d32c7e86cb3ba9bf875a8fb5d21bf838a431ea4fd4f317487bfc680794a:25

value
1784944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b465090e90b663b286331017e18fa8013acca6a9 OP_EQUALVERIFY OP_CHECKSIG
address
1HSqfbFveRxJ7wgYRG4aCGxEcucFqLZEpa
transaction
6f524d32c7e86cb3ba9bf875a8fb5d21bf838a431ea4fd4f317487bfc680794a
spent
true